PMHUB-G PMBOK 5 again - good news and bad news?

PMI is scheduled to publish the 5th Edition of the PMBOK® Guide on Jan 1, 2013 and we can expect the PMP and CAPM exams to change on the third quarter of 2013. So practically we have about 6 months to deal with PMP/CAPM Exam based on PMBOK 4 [...]

PMHUB-G New PMBOK, what to do?

Read this article: http://www.pmhub.net/wp/2012/07/the-perennial-question-the-new-pmbok-is-soon-out-should-i-write-the-exam-now-or-later/


And a great comment by a member:

1 comment to The Perennial Question: The New PMBOK is soon out – Should I write the Exam now or later?

  • PMI has announced that the test based on PMBOK5 will not be available until July 2013. And we know from seeing an exposure draft that instead of there being 9 knowledge areas there will be 10. So, more to study. And further, we know that they'll mix up the Inputs, Outputs, Tools and Techniques enough that PMBOK4 will effectively no longer be a useful study tool.

    So my advice would be if you have the time and bandwidth to study now, study and take the test ASAP. No reason at all to wait. If you feel like you're missing something by not studying PMBOK5, well the new knowledge area is Stakeholder Management, something currently covered under Communications. So all they've really done is pulled an already existing piece of knowledge out and elevated it to its own knowledge area.

PMHUB-G John P. Reiling, PMP: A Balance of “Style” and “Substance” Will Bring You PM Success

Style without substance – or substance without style – is sure to reduce your effectiveness on projects.

Here's why.

SUBSTANCE – a "left brain" operation characterized by logic, language and analytical thinking – is all about WHAT you communicate.

STYLE – a "right brain" operation related to expressive and creative tasks – is all about HOW you communicate.

Here's why both style and substance are equally important for your effectiveness on projects:
